Visual Field Plotting Using Eye Movement Response

TL;DR: An approach is described which encourages the natural eye movement response and objectively classifies it as either an acquisition or a search response, and empirical results demonstrate the reliability ofEye movement response as an index of perception of peripheral stimuli.

Compensation for Distortion in Eye-Movement Monitors

TL;DR: A compensation scheme for the correction of both horizontal and vertical eye position measurements is developed and a new sample point structure is introduced that permits both fixation-based and tracking-based sampling strategies.
